Audit Prods L.A. To Tackle Backlog In DNA Evidence

Dec 12th, 2008 · In Los Angeles, more than 12,000 DNA evidence kits taken from sexual assault victims wait untested in police crime labs and storage facilities. Police say they haven't had the money or the technology to deal with the backlog. But a scathing city audit has officials pledging to test every rape kit — and to help victims bring criminals to justice.

Scientists Pursue CO2 Storage In The Ocean Floor *

Jul 25th, 2008 · Could porous rocks deep in the ocean floor be a place to stash unwanted carbon dioxide? Scientists at the Lamont-Doherty Earth Observatory suggest that undersea basalt formations 8,000 feet below the ocean on the Pacific Northwest coast could absorb up to 120 years worth of U.S. CO2 emissions.

High Fuel Prices Keep Boats Docked

May 22nd, 2008 · The summer season in New Hampshire's Lakes Region is just getting started, but as gas prices continue to set records on land, some boat owners are keeping their vessels in storage or selling them altogether. That's already starting to affect marinas that store, dock, rent and sell boats. Other businesses, such as charter boats and tourist cruises, are setting their summer rates and weighing whether to swallow high fuel costs or pass them on to customers.

New Orleans Museum to Reclaim Artifacts *

Apr 19th, 2008 · After Hurricane Katrina, the Louisiana State Museum in New Orleans' French Quarter evacuated 200,000 artifacts to Baton Rouge, where they've sat in storage ever since. Now the artifacts are all coming home.

FBI Searches Utah Sites Tied to Vegas Ricin Case

Mar 3rd, 2008 · A man who was likely exposed to the toxin ricin last week remains in a coma after being found in his Las Vegas hotel room. The man had recently moved to Nevada from Salt Lake City. Federal agents have searched storage units and another home where he stayed in Utah.
